I guess it all depends how well your car is running. Sometimes people may have faulty parts. I for example went in for a tune but didn't know that my massair was pegged at 5400rpms and injectors went up to 100%DC. That can add time to tuning and troubleshooting. I'm sure if everything is running tip top then I could see it a little less. I think that is the going rate with all tuners. The price of a chip and whatever time it will take to tune. Some cars will tune easier than others. I have seen great work from this shop otherwise I would not recommend them. Also heard great things about the other shops listed above.
